Executive Summary

This 2020 compilation contains about 85.3 million U.S. voter records with names and home addresses. Voter registration data is publicly available to varying degrees by state, and this dataset aggregates such records into a single circulating file.

ObscureIQ assessment: High risk of identity theft, political targeting, doxxing, and government-themed phishing. Voter datasets are especially useful for residential targeting and ideological profiling.

Breach Impact

Names paired with home addresses support physical-location profiling, targeted mail/phishing, and doxxing; the data is largely public-record but its aggregation lowers the effort to target individuals at scale.

About USA Voter

This record is an aggregation of U.S. voter registration records, much of which is derived from publicly available state voter rolls rather than a breach of a single system.

Why They Hold Your Data

Voter-record datasets aggregate identity, address, party-registration, precinct, and election-linked records tied to public voter registration systems.

Recent Developments

Aggregated voter datasets have repeatedly surfaced in circulation; availability and sensitivity of voter data vary by state.
